Figure 6.
IL-2 induced decreases in proliferation of the CD4+/CD25+ subset that were strongly correlated with the expansion of this subset. (A) Representative density plot of CD4+ T cells at month 0 and month 12 from an IL-2 group patient, examining surface expression of CD25 and intracellular expression of Ki67. The striking increase of the CD4+/CD25+ subset at month 12 can be noted. (B) Paired data and median percent expression of Ki67 in CD4+/CD25+ T cells in the IL-2 group at month 0 and month 12. A statistically significant decrease in Ki67 expression was noted (P < .001) at month 12 compared to month 0. (C) No statistically significant changes were observed in Ki67 expression in the CD4+/CD25–T cells. (D) A strong association was found between the decreases in Ki67 expression of the CD4+/CD25+ T cells and the increases in the number of these cells (Spearman correlation, r = –0.9, P < .001).
